My other thoughts here would be that the dealer has to make money on both your trade and the new vehicle. If they can't they won't trade. Normally I won't waste my time with a trade because I can generally sell it myself for at least 10% more than a dealer can give me. The last time I traded a vehicle with a dealer was 1978. I think people trade because they don't like dealing with the unwashed masses to sell a vehicle, certainly not for everyone. There's a sea of perspective buyers out there that absolutely won't buy a used vehicle from a dealer.
But in favor of a trade, there is less sales tax to be paid on the purchase. In this state the tax is almost 10% so depending on the vehicle sales price it could be thousands of dollars.
